"Rail Explorers: Bluegrass Division" is a unique tourist attraction located in the picturesque city of Versailles, in the very heart of a region famous for its horses and bourbon. This adventure involves riding special pedal-powered railbikes along historic railway tracks that are no longer used for regular train traffic.
The distinct feature of this entertainment is the use of the patented REX Propulsion System—electric motors that assist with pedaling. Thanks to this, the journey becomes easy and accessible for people of almost any age and fitness level. Visitors can enjoy views of the Kentucky hills, passing by famous horse farms and limestone cliffs without experiencing exhausting physical strain.
This place is perfect for family vacations, romantic dates, or fun trips with friends. Traveling along the steel thoroughfares, guests discover the USA from an unusual perspective, combining outdoor activity with an immersion into railway history.
